What Beijing Rising Adware (PUA) virus can do?

  • Sample contains Overlay data
  • Reads data out of its own binary image
  • Unconventionial language used in binary resources: Chinese (Simplified)
  • Authenticode signature is invalid
  • Anomalous binary characteristics
